Driver license clerk education requirements

Updated January 8, 2025
2 min read
Usually, driver license clerks don't need a college education. The most common degree for driver license clerks is high school diploma with 30% graduates, with only 27% driver license clerk graduates earning bachelor's degree. Driver license clerks who decided to graduate from college often finish Peru State College or City College of New York of the City University of New York, The. Some good skills to have in this position include reliable transportation, field training and motor vehicle.

What should I major in to become a driver license clerk?

You should major in business to become a driver license clerk. 26% of driver license clerks major in business. Other common majors for a driver license clerk include criminal justice and accounting.

Best majors for driver license clerks

RankMajorPercentages
1Business26.0%
2Criminal Justice10.6%
3Accounting6.7%
4Psychology5.8%
5Liberal Arts5.8%

Average driver license clerk salary by education level

According to our data, driver license clerks with a Bachelor's degree earn the highest average salary, at $35,012 annually. Driver license clerks with a Associate degree earn an average annual salary of $33,612.
Driver license clerk education levelDriver license clerk salary
High School Diploma or Less$33,436
Bachelor's Degree$35,012
Some College/ Associate Degree$33,612
